"While the firm has been collaborating with Colliers International for over a decade, this integration will allow us to more seamlessly tie into the vast array of services which Colliers International provides on a global basis," says chairman David Kahnweiler "Local, national and worldwide clients will continue to benefit from our local expertise and market knowledge as well as our global market coverage and relationships."

A price tag on the investment was not disclosed.

Colliers B&K was started in 1947 and now has a management portfolio that totals 50 million square feet in the Chicago-land area. The company has more than 200 professionals. Colliers International has said its investment will not result in any personnel or management changes within Colliers B&K.

Colliers International has more than 15,000 employees throughout 61 countries. Jointly Colliers International and its affiliates manage more than 1.5 billion square feet of property. Colliers International is a subsidiary of FirstService Corp.

"Colliers International is focused on accelerating success for our company and, most importantly, for our clients," says Doug Frye, president and CEO of Colliers International. "Enabling our new Chicago hub to enhance client service in a highly collaborative organization is a critical component of our vision for the company."
